Hi all,

With some changes in the Mercury MVC source code I was able to compile it for mod_harbour 2.0. I still studying the source code of Mercury, to see if there are another changes that may be needed.

All the examples are working without any problem, including my own webservice (very simple) that I developed and will deploy in production next week

For the examples, just change LoadHRB with MH_LoadHRB and it will work perfectly

My changes in Mercury MVC is in my github (https://github.com/neoangeiras/mercury)
